Cora Island – Restoring Habitat

Cora Island – Restoring Habitat

The Cora Island Project was a component of the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ers overall Missouri River Recovery Program.  In cooperation with the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service the goal was to restore 1,265 acres of shallow water habitat by constructing channel chutes...
